NBC SPORTS REACHES AGREEMENT TO TELEVISE XTREME FIGHTING CHAMPIONSHIPS – XFC43, NOV. 11 ON NBCSN

Main Event Fights of Relaunch Event to Air Live at 9p.m. ET

September 8, 2020

DESTIN, FLORIDA, (NEWS MEDIA WIRE) – Duke Mountain Resources Inc. (OTC: DKMR) has reached an agreement with NBC Sports to present the Xtreme Fighting Championships (“XFC”) live in the United States.

“We are pleased to partner with XFC and showcase their action-packed bouts and exciting fighters to fans in the United States,” says Gary Quinn, Vice President, Programming & Owned Properties, NBC Sports.

NBCSN will televise XFC43 on Veteran’s Day, November 11, 2020 at 9 p.m. ET, featuring live action from the final two hours of ‘main event’ fights.

XFC is returning to the Hexagon under a new ownership group led by CEO Steve Smith and President Myron Molotky.  Each fight night will feature bouts from XFC’s three competition series; Young Guns (up-and-coming fighters), Tournament Series (bracket-format fights leading to a weight class champion) and Super Fights (highest-profile and most-established fighters).

“NBC Sports is the gold standard in sports television, with an unmatched history presenting  the most prestigious competitions in the world,” says Molotky. “The team at NBC Sports impressed us with their experience, their understanding of our vision, and their commitment to excellence.  We are thrilled to join them as partners and to give our fighters an opportunity to shine in front of this powerful audience.”

XFC43 is slated for November 11 with contingencies in place for a future date should health and travel conditions in the United States require sliding later.  Announcements about international distribution of XFC43 as well as production and talent hires are forthcoming.
